La dolce vita (sweet life)

An Italian-French co-production film made in 1960. A masterpiece by director Federico Fellini, it won the Grand Prix at the Cannes Film Festival. The film depicts, with a strong sense of plasticity, the process by which aspiring writer Marcello (Marcello Mastroianni) becomes addicted to a decadent lifestyle while reporting on the glamorous world of showbiz and high society as a gossip writer. Although it was strongly criticized by the Church, the theme of soul salvation that is highlighted throughout the film cannot be thought of in isolation from Catholicism. The film is particularly famous for the provocative scene in which Anita Ekberg (1931-2015), who plays a Hollywood star, bathes in the Trevi Fountain, and the film drew attention along with the presence of photographers known as paparazzi. Among Fellini's works, which are said to have strong autobiographical elements, this film also has elements of a sequel to "A Portrait of a Youth" (1953), in which the protagonist, also an aspiring writer, runs away from his hometown, and Mastroianni appears for the first time as a character who is like a doppelganger of the director.
